Responsibilities
- Support the Director in developing and executing merchandising strategies that drive revenue growth and portfolio evolution
- Analyze SKU, collection, and category-level performance to identify business insights and recommend opportunities to optimize assortment depth, breadth, and mix
- Aid in the development and execution of launch strategies for new collections, including assortment readiness, site placement, and post-launch performance tracking
- Evaluate product lifecycle performance and recommend actions related to continuation, expansion, repositioning, or discontinuation
- Monitor competitor strategies, market conditions, customer behavior, and industry trends to inform merchandising recommendations and new product opportunities
- Partner with Finance and Planning teams to support demand forecasting, assortment planning, margin analysis, and inventory productivity
- Translate analytics into clear, actionable insights and recommendations for the Director and cross-functional partners
- Develop, maintain, and improve dashboards and reporting tools to track performance, identify trends, and support real-time decision-making
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in business, Economics, Analytics, Marketing, Merchandising, or a related field
- 5 - 8+ years of experience in merchandising, site merchandising, analytics, e-commerce, retail, or a related role
- Strong analytical and quantitative skills, with proficiency in tools such as Excel, SQL, Tableau, Looker, Power BI, or similar platforms
- The ability to translate complex data into clear insights, business implications, and actionable recommendations
- A strong understanding of e-commerce merchandising principles, digital customer experience, and product storytelling
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ively across functions
- A balanced approach to creative judgment and quantitative decision-making
